Shenzhen reports 1 new imported COVID-19 case

SHENZHEN, Dec. 1 (Xinhua) -- The southern metropolis of Shenzhen reported one new imported COVID-19 case Tuesday, the municipal health commission said.

The patient is a 60-year-old truck driver living in Hong Kong who transports goods between Shenzhen, south China's Guangdong Province, and Hong Kong every day. He showed symptoms of mild cough Sunday and tested positive for the novel coronavirus Monday. He was confirmed to be a COVID-19 case Tuesday.

Authorities have placed 52 people under isolated observation, including the driver's 11 close contacts and their 41 close contacts. All 52 have tested negative for the virus.

Authorities in Shenzhen's Longgang District will conduct nucleic acid tests on residents based on the locations visited by the newly confirmed COVID-19 case. Enditem
